ATVI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

716 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Activision Blizzard (ATVI)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$37.8B — up 15% from $33B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 104 funds opened new ATVI positions and 67 closed out — a net gain of 37 holders — while 275 added to existing stakes and 258 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Janus Henderson Group, adding an estimated $999M. The largest seller was Boston Partners, cutting an estimated $216M.
